Understanding Your Digital Foundation
Success in social media marketing isn't about being everywhere at once. It's about being present and engaging where your target audience spends their time. Before diving into multiple platforms, research where your potential customers hang out online and what type of content resonates with them.
Starting Smart: Platform Selection
Rather than spreading yourself thin across every available platform, focus on mastering one or two channels initially. Each platform has its unique characteristics:
LinkedIn works best for B2B relationships and professional services. Instagram excels at visual storytelling and product showcases. Twitter shines for real-time engagement and industry news. Choose based on where your audience is most active and engaged.
Content Creation on a Budget
Creating engaging content doesn't require expensive equipment or a large team. Start with your smartphone and some basic editing apps. Focus on authenticity over perfection – today's audiences often prefer genuine, behind-the-scenes content to polished corporate messages.
The Power of Planning
Consistency matters more than frequency in social media success. While major brands might post multiple times daily, you can achieve significant impact with 3-4 quality posts per week. The key lies in planning and scheduling your content effectively.

Engagement Strategies That Work
Social media success isn't just about broadcasting – it's about building relationships. Allocate time each day for:
- Responding to comments promptly
- Joining relevant conversations
- Engaging with your followers' content
- Participating in industry discussions
Measuring What Matters
Don't get caught up in vanity metrics. Focus on engagement rates, click-throughs, and conversions rather than just follower counts. Set clear, measurable goals and track your progress regularly.
Community Building Techniques
Build a community around your brand by:
- Sharing user-generated content
- Creating branded hashtags
- Hosting live sessions
- Running Q&A segments
Maximizing Organic Reach
While paid advertising has its place, organic reach can still be powerful when done right:
- Post at optimal times for your audience
- Use relevant hashtags strategically
- Create shareable content
- Encourage employee advocacy
Content Repurposing
Make your content work harder by repurposing it across platforms:
- Turn blog posts into social media carousels
- Convert customer testimonials into graphics
- Transform webinars into short video clips
- Create infographics from data-heavy content
The Human Touch
Remember that social media is fundamentally about human connection. Share your company's story, celebrate team members, and showcase your company culture. These personal touches help build authentic relationships with your audience.
Looking Ahead
As social media continues to evolve, stay flexible and ready to adapt. Keep testing new features and formats, but always align them with your core strategy and business goals.
